    Abstract - (Show below) - (Hide below)

    Applies to thermosetting resins and glass-fibre reinforcement used in the construction of small craft with a length of the hull (LH) not exceeding 24 m, in compliance with ISO 8666. It specifies the minimum requirements for material properties of glass reinforcement and resin matrix and the reference laminate made thereof.
